The Fray is a rock band formed in 2002. The band's debut album How to Save a Life (album) was released September 2005. The Fray released 1 studio album, 2 live albums, and 2 EP's. The Fray created singles How to Save a Life, Over My Head (Cable Car), Look After You, Vienna, and All at Once.
